The statement "You must have a password to log in to the test drive company" is generally true. To access secure systems such as a test drive company's electronic resources, authentication is typically required.

A password is one form of authentication and it serves to protect the user's account and the company's data from unauthorized access. While this is the standard practice, it's important to note that the specific requirements could vary depending on the company's security protocols. Some systems may use other forms of authentication such as biometrics or multi-factor authentication in addition to or instead of a traditional password.
